Ensure all first aid equipment, i.e wound bandaging are all sterile by ensuring their packaging is not damaged.
Washing hands correctly.
Wearing gloves.
Use appropriate bin when disposing used first aid equipment, for example plasters into clinical waste bag.
Using anti-bacterial hand gel prior and after entering or leaving a room. Also when treating patient. This should not replace washing your hands.
